Zechariah 1:13-17
New American Standard Bible
13 And the Lord responded to the (A)angel who was speaking with me with [a]gracious words, (B)comforting words. 14 So the angel who was speaking with me said to me, “(C)Proclaim, saying, ‘This is what the Lord of armies says: “I am (D)exceedingly jealous for Jerusalem and Zion. 15 But I am very (E)angry with the nations who are (F)carefree; for while I was only a little angry, they [b](G)furthered the disaster.” 16 Therefore the Lord says this: “I will (H)return to Jerusalem with compassion; My (I)house will be built in it,” declares the Lord of armies, “and a measuring (J)line will be stretched over Jerusalem.”’ 17 Again, proclaim, saying, ‘This is what the Lord of armies says: “My (K)cities will again overflow with prosperity, and the Lord will again (L)comfort Zion and again (M)choose Jerusalem.”’”
